A general college fraternity, such as Pi Kappa Phi, participates in many different college activities. On the social side, we organize socials with sororities, have tailgate parties before football games, and enjoy various other brother activities. In athletics we compete against other organizations and fraternities in softball, basketball, football, soccer, and volleyball. A unique facet of our fraternity is also our national philanthropy, PUSH America. Last, but not certainly not least, with the help of our scholarship chair and study tables, we encourage scholarship and academic achievement.

Pi Kapp Facts

Founded December 10, 1904 at College of Charleston, Charleston, SC
Over 150 chapters nationwide
Over 80,000 initiated members
Colors: Gold & White
Auxiliary Color: Royal Blue
Flower: Red Rose
National Headquarters: Charlotte, NC
Only Fraternity to start its own national outreach program -- PUSH America
Raised over $3 million dollars for PUSH America while modifying 190 Easter Seals camps, and donating 3.2 million man labor hours (worth an estimated $26 million dollars)
Fastest growing fraternity in the country
